HeatMapCo

HeatMapCo

HeatMapCo is a heatmap and click analytics tool that helps website owners understand how visitors interact with their site. It generates heatmaps showing click patterns, scroll depth, and other user behaviors.

cux.io

cux.io

Cux.io is a cloud-based data integration platform that allows you to visually map data flows between various data sources and destinations. It provides pre-built connectors to commonly used apps and data sources like SQL, MongoDB, REST APIs, FTP, and more.
